Transaction d8e1354e4e0c38d3420fb032146ee0a3bdea3fb84ed581875260b6f46495ca71

block
62a436d47fb52c06806cbec1e0313783d20055f643304c560dcf42ffab2c47ad

1 Input

23 Outputs